Clinical characteristics of chronic urticaria patients with and without systemic flares
Abstract:
Intraduction: Chronic urticaria (CU) is not classified as a mast cell activation syndrome; however, some patients experience systemic flares fulfilling anaphylaxis criteria without identifiable triggers, posing diagnostic and therapeutic challenges. To characterize CU patients with systemic flares and identify factors associated with recurrent episodes.
Methods:
In this retrospective study at a tertiary allergy center, patients diagnosed with CU between 2015 and 2025 were screened. Among these, 192 had confirmed chronic urticaria based on disease duration and clinical evaluation. Patients with inducible urticaria subtypes associated with anaphylaxis and those with identifiable trigger-related reactions were excluded to avoid misclassification. The final cohort consisted of 70 patients, including 36 with systemic flares fulfilling clinical criteria for anaphylaxis and 34 without systemic flares.
Results:
A total of 70 patients (64.0% female; mean age 39.3±13.6 years) were included.Systemic flares occurred in 36 (51%) patients, most commonly presenting as moderate anaphylaxis (86.1%). Compared to group without systemic flares, blood basophil and lymphocyte counts were higher in the systemic-flare group. Higher lymphocyte counts were independently associated with systemic flares (OR = 3.35; 95%CI 1.31-8.56; p = 0.012), whereas baseline serum tryptase levels were not (OR = 0.77; 95%CI 0.57-1.04; p = 0.083). Patients with systemic flares were less likely to require escalation to second-line therapy with omalizumab for urticaria control (OR = 0.11; 95% CI 0.02-0.79; p = 0.028). Gastrointestinal involvement emerged as the sole independent predictor of recurrence (OR = 8.24; 95%CI 1.24-54.71; p = 0.029).
Conclusion:
This study identifies a subgroup of patients with CU who experience systemic flares fulfilling anaphylaxis criteria, and exhibit well-controlled urticaria with antihistamines, a lower need for omalizumab, and higher peripheral lymphocyte counts. Systemic flares with gastrointestinal symptoms was a risk factor for recurrent systemic flares in CU. Our findings suggest that a subset of patients with chronic urticaria may experience recurrent systemic flares accompanied by certain clinical differences and treatment patterns compared with conventional CU, although further prospective studies are needed to better characterize this group.
